Trump, Netanyahu Agree to Escalate Economic Pressure on Iran
President Donald Trump and Israeli Prime Minister Benjamin Netanyahu meet at the White House and commit to a full-force maximum pressure campaign against Iran, targeting its oil sales to China, which account for 80 percent of Tehran's exports. This bold move aims to choke Iran's economy and force Tehran to abandon its nuclear ambitions, with Trump ready to slap 25 percent tariffs on China for defying sanctions. Read more about this...
